Title :
Study on print ink presetting through singular value decomposition

Abstract :
This paper proposes a method of calculating ink supply amount. In terms of the image coverage data of digital prepress file, by the way of letting every ink-zone feed ink in turn, we can calculate ink distribution on the paper by the use of computer simulation, hence a matrix that reflects ink flow characteristics of the inking system under the current image coverage can be established. When given the requirements of ink amount on the paper, the output ink can be derived to preset ink key based on truncated singular value decomposition.
